Unveiling Transformative Technological Evolutions and Regulatory Developments Reshaping the Meniscus Repair Anchor Ecosystem in Modern Healthcare Environments
The meniscus repair anchor landscape is undergoing a period of unprecedented transformation driven by technological innovation and evolving regulatory standards. Recent advances in biodegradable materials and bioactive coatings have catalyzed a shift toward anchors that not only secure tissue but also promote cellular integration and healing. Simultaneously, the rise of all-inside deployment techniques, powered by compact delivery systems, is streamlining surgical workflows and enhancing procedural accuracy.Regulatory frameworks in key regions have adapted to these innovations, with expedited pathways for devices demonstrating clear clinical benefit. This regulatory evolution has encouraged manufacturers to invest in robust pre-clinical and clinical validation, accelerating time to market for next-generation anchors. Moreover, reimbursement models are increasingly favoring minimally invasive procedures, fostering broader adoption of advanced anchor systems in both hospital operating rooms and ambulatory surgical centers.
Transitional dynamics such as surgeon training programs, value-based contracting models, and digital surgical planning tools are further reshaping the competitive architecture. Collaborative partnerships between medical device companies and healthcare institutions are establishing centers of excellence that serve as testbeds for novel anchor designs and surgical protocols. In sum, the confluence of material science breakthroughs, refined regulatory pathways, and stakeholder collaboration is redefining the future of meniscus repair anchor applications.

Delivering Key Segmentation Perspectives Emphasizing Product Type Material Composition Application Methodologies and End User Requirements Driving Market Differentiation
A nuanced examination of product segmentation reveals distinct drivers of differentiation within the meniscus repair anchor space. All-inside anchors continue to gain traction for their minimally invasive delivery and reduced soft-tissue disruption, while inside-out configurations retain relevance in complex tear patterns. Outside-in solutions offer a compromise between surgical accessibility and fixation versatility, and trans-patellar designs are leveraged in specific suture anchoring scenarios requiring maximal tensile strength.Material composition further delineates performance profiles and adoption rates. Bioabsorbable polymer anchors remain favored for applications demanding gradual load transfer and tissue remodeling, whereas titanium variants are chosen for their superior initial fixation strength and radiographic visibility. As such, clinicians balance these trade-offs based on patient demographics, tear morphology, and long-term rehabilitation goals.
Application methodology underscores the importance of procedural context, with arthroscopic techniques dominating in outpatient surgical suites and open approaches reserved for revision cases or anatomically challenging tears. End users, including ambulatory surgical centers, hospitals, and specialty clinics, exhibit distinct purchasing behaviors influenced by procedural volumes, capital expenditure cycles, and post-operative care models. Together, these segmentation insights inform tailored product development and go-to-market strategies that align with clinical needs and organizational imperatives.
